Rudolf Stingel is an artist who challenges conventional ideas of the creative process. His art works explore the relationship of art and space. Stingel uses different modern mediums in a way that creates an interaction with the space of the exhibit. In one of his most famous works, he used pieces inspired by 17th and 16th century Transylvanian rugs to cover the Palazzo Grassi. This 2013 exhibition was an imaginative use of carpets as a medium, but if we look beyond the surface, we might be able to gain insights into antique rugs as a medium of self-expression that applies today.
